Transaction 28361fe3236c7d9256611c4eb11107bcb44515b296500f76b40c7b4359382307

1 Input
2 Outputs
  • 28361fe3236c7d9256611c4eb11107bcb44515b296500f76b40c7b4359382307:0
  • value  29239
    address  bc1q5q8x6fgud3ppepuwlcg2hweuwzuumafspc63xl
  • 28361fe3236c7d9256611c4eb11107bcb44515b296500f76b40c7b4359382307:1
  • value  1970183
    address  3KGee5rtvWHsf64YdSJwrPUZLdeFzeRb3Z